As a freelance designer, you have the freedom to work on projects that you are passionate about and to set your own hours. However, there are also many challenges that come with being a freelance designer. Here are some of the most common challenges that freelancers face.
1. Finding Clients: One of the biggest challenges of being a freelance designer is finding clients. You need to be able to market yourself and your services in order to attract potential clients. This can be a difficult task, especially if you are just starting out. You may need to invest in marketing materials, such as a website or business cards, in order to get your name out there.
2. Setting Rates: Another challenge of being a freelance designer is setting your rates. You need to be able to determine how much you should charge for your services in order to make a profit. This can be difficult, as you need to consider the cost of materials, the amount of time it will take to complete the project, and the value of your work.
3. Managing Time: As a freelance designer, you are responsible for managing your own time. This can be difficult, as you need to be able to balance your work and personal life. You also need to be able to stay organized and prioritize tasks in order to meet deadlines.
4. Staying Motivated: It can be difficult to stay motivated when you are working on your own. You need to be able to push yourself to stay on task and to complete projects in a timely manner.
5. Dealing with Rejection: As a freelance designer, you will likely face rejection from potential clients. You need to be able to handle this rejection in a professional manner and to move on to the next project.
Being a freelance designer can be a rewarding and fulfilling career. However, it is important to be aware of the challenges that come with it. By understanding these challenges, you can be better prepared to handle them and to succeed as a freelance designer.
